2018 MOP to BHD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2018

During 2018, the MOP to BHD ex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on June 26, valuing the pair at 0.0472.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on May 1, dropping to 0.0465.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0007 BHD.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0468 to the December average rate of 0.0468, the exchange rate registered a net change of -0.07%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2018 high of 0.0472 was down 0.74% compared to the 2017 peak of 0.0476,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.
